驼铃远去 风笛响起——“钢铁驼队”续写开放新篇章
Zhong Guo Jin Rong Xin Xi Wang· 2025-11-16 13:05
Core Viewpoint - The Xi'an International Port has transformed into a key logistics hub connecting Europe and Asia through the China-Europe Railway Express, achieving significant growth in freight volume and operational efficiency over the past decade [1][2]. Group 1: Operational Achievements - The Xi'an International Port has seen over 30,000 China-Europe Railway Express trains dispatched since its inception in 2013, maintaining the highest operational metrics in the country for several consecutive years [1]. - In 2024, the port set a record with 24 trains dispatched within a 24-hour period, showcasing its operational efficiency [2]. - The port's annual throughput capacity has reached 5.4 million TEUs (Twenty-foot Equivalent Units) after three expansions, covering an area of 5,600 acres with 59 operational lines [2]. Group 2: Strategic Developments - The implementation of a multi-channel strategy has been crucial for maintaining high operational speed, with new routes significantly reducing transport times from over 40 days to approximately 15 days [2]. - The collaboration with Kazakhstan's Almaty port has created a dual-hub linkage, enhancing cost efficiency and operational effectiveness by matching cargo and container sources accurately [2]. Group 3: Digital Transformation - The introduction of a comprehensive service platform has simplified international freight processes, allowing users to book cargo space and complete customs procedures online, akin to an e-commerce experience [3]. - The "Smart Logistics Supervision System" has been launched, enabling low-risk cargo to enjoy 24-hour automatic clearance, significantly reducing processing times from four hours to mere seconds [3][4]. Group 4: Economic Impact - The China-Europe Railway Express has catalyzed the integration of various industries, including automotive manufacturing and smart home appliances, in Xi'an and its surrounding areas [5]. - The Xi'an Chang'an International Port has attracted 380 companies in the cross-border e-commerce sector, with dedicated trains operating over 500 times and achieving a transaction volume exceeding 10.5 billion yuan [6]. - The establishment of a "three-in-one" industrial chain by Xi'an Aijiu Grain and Oil Industrial Group has facilitated the import of 92,000 tons of high-quality agricultural products from Kazakhstan in the first ten months of the year [6].
广汇物流新签700万吨“疆煤外运”外部客户订单 预计将带来超6亿元收入
Zheng Quan Shi Bao Wang· 2025-11-16 09:28
Core Insights - Guanghui Logistics has signed transportation agreements with multiple external clients for the year 2026, with a total contract volume exceeding 7 million tons [1][2] - The company has seen a significant increase in its transportation capacity due to the gradual implementation of key railway projects in Xinjiang [1] - Guanghui Logistics reported a year-on-year increase of 38.95% in transportation volume for the first nine months of 2025, accounting for approximately 30% of Xinjiang's total coal transportation [1] Group 1 - The total contract volume for the newly signed agreements is over 7 million tons, with a total contract value of approximately 700 million yuan [1] - The new orders represent the company's first annual contracts for the transportation of semi-coke and blown coal with external clients [1] - The company aims to further expand its market share and achieve business growth through the utilization of the newly operational railways [1] Group 2 - The recent orders have broadened the company's business scope and strengthened its market position in Xinjiang's coal transportation sector [2] - The agreements enhance the brand influence of the company as a key player in the Xinjiang coal transportation corridor [2]
郑州外贸再“提前”
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-11-15 08:57
Core Insights - The article highlights the rapid growth of cross-border e-commerce in Zhengzhou, particularly during the "Double Eleven" shopping festival, with a significant increase in order volume and export value [2][4]. Group 1: Cross-Border E-Commerce Growth - Zhengzhou's cross-border e-commerce has seen a remarkable increase, with over 243 billion yuan in import and export value this year, marking a nearly 24% year-on-year growth [2]. - The average daily outbound orders have reached around 70,000, accounting for more than one-third of the total business volume at the Henan Bonded Logistics Center [2]. - On "Double Eleven," the order volume approached 200,000, showcasing the peak demand during the shopping festival [2]. Group 2: Air Cargo and Logistics Expansion - Zhengzhou Airport has achieved a cumulative cargo volume of 825,200 tons by November 3, representing a 24.76% year-on-year increase, surpassing last year's total cargo volume ahead of schedule [3]. - The airport's international cargo volume has consistently increased, with over 60% of the total cargo being international, supported by the "Air Silk Road" initiative [3]. - The number of international cargo flights has exceeded 50 per week, with a total of 68 all-cargo routes established, enhancing global connectivity [3]. Group 3: Overall Trade Performance - In the first ten months, Henan Province's total import and export value reached 741.12 billion yuan, reflecting a 14.5% year-on-year growth [4]. - Zhengzhou's total import and export value for the first three quarters was 433.25 billion yuan, with exports alone amounting to 285.57 billion yuan, indicating a 35.7% increase [4]. - The growth in exports is primarily driven by products such as computers, communication technology, mobile phones, and automobiles [4].
畅通循环、优化服务——多地推进物流行业降本增效
Jing Ji Ri Bao· 2025-11-14 23:49
Core Insights - The total logistics cost in China for the first three quarters of this year reached 14.2 trillion yuan, with a ratio to GDP of 14.0%, marking a decrease of 0.1 percentage points compared to the same period last year, maintaining the lowest level since statistics began [1] Group 1: Policy and Government Initiatives - The Chinese government is actively promoting cost reduction and efficiency improvement in the logistics industry through various policies, including the issuance of opinions on accelerating the construction of rural logistics systems and action plans to effectively lower logistics costs [1] - Local governments are implementing related policies and measures to enhance transportation efficiency and reduce logistics costs [1] Group 2: Infrastructure and Network Development - In Guangdong, increasing the proportion of railway freight volume and reducing logistics costs across multimodal transport chains are crucial for improving logistics efficiency [2] - The Guangzhou East Rail and Road Intermodal Hub has become a significant logistics hub, with 1,398 international trains dispatched by September this year, valued at 35.15 billion yuan, covering 34 cities in 17 countries [2] - Hubei province is enhancing its infrastructure connectivity, with plans to increase railway freight turnover by approximately 10% by 2027 and an annual growth of around 15% in port container intermodal transport [2] Group 3: Innovations in Logistics Services - The opening of the Qiantang District's Xiasha Port in Hangzhou has established a water transport network covering 13 routes, significantly reducing logistics costs by over 300 yuan per container compared to road transport [3] - The introduction of unmanned delivery vehicles in rural areas has increased delivery frequency and volume, with a 30% year-on-year growth in package deliveries [4] - The integration of transportation resources by the Guangzhou Railway Bureau and customs has improved overall customs efficiency by over 30% [5] Group 4: Financial Innovations Supporting Logistics - Financial institutions in Zhejiang are encouraged to innovate financial products like "freight loans" and "warehouse receipt pledges" to support logistics companies [7] - A logistics company in Shaoxing received a credit of 1.4 million yuan within a week to expand its operations, demonstrating the responsiveness of financial services to market needs [7] - Hubei province is promoting a model that integrates passenger and freight transport to reduce delivery costs, with 71 county-level comprehensive service centers established [7]

新疆自贸试验区成立两周年 改革试点任务完成超八成
Xin Hua Wang· 2025-11-14 08:39
Core Insights - The Xinjiang Free Trade Zone has achieved significant progress in institutional innovation and economic development since its establishment on November 1, 2023, with a completion rate of 81.5% for reform pilot tasks by October 2023, surpassing the target of over 80% for the second year [1] - The zone has seen the establishment of over 18,000 new enterprises, bringing the total to 44,000, and recorded an import-export volume of 155.33 billion yuan, accounting for nearly 40% of the region's total [1][2] Group 1: Institutional and Economic Development - The Xinjiang Free Trade Zone has implemented 72 provincial-level institutional innovation achievements, which have been promoted throughout the region [1] - A total of 69 supportive policies have been introduced, and 45 economic and social management powers have been delegated to enhance the business environment [1] Group 2: Logistics and Trade Enhancement - The zone is enhancing its logistics hub capabilities with the construction of land and air port-type national logistics hubs, and the full application of "direct loading" for China-Europe (Central Asia) trains [2] - The international air network has expanded, with 28 international passenger routes and 36 international cargo routes, covering multiple countries and cities [2] Group 3: Foreign Trade and Investment - The Xinjiang Free Trade Zone has established 43 overseas and border warehouses, facilitating a multi-warehouse cross-border logistics model [2] - The zone has seen nearly 40% of new foreign enterprises established in the region, with ongoing innovations in foreign exchange business trials and management mechanisms [2] Group 4: International Cooperation - The zone is deepening cooperation with Central Asian countries and members of the Shanghai Cooperation Organization in various fields, including trade, industry, energy, and technology [2] - Platforms such as the "Belt and Road" joint laboratory and international offshore innovation centers have been established to support these collaborations [2]
